Understanding MSG Seating Capacity for Hockey
When it comes to hockey games, MSG seating capacity is a topic that gets fans buzzing. The arena, located in the heart of New York City, can seat around 18,200 fans for hockey matches. This number fluctuates slightly depending on the event configuration, but for NHL games, the capacity remains consistent.
What makes MSG unique is its versatility. Unlike other arenas, MSG is designed to host a variety of events, from concerts to basketball games. For hockey, the seating arrangement is optimized to provide the best possible experience for fans. The rink is positioned in the center, surrounded by tiered seating that ensures everyone has a clear view of the action.

The History of MSG and Hockey
Madison Square Garden has a rich history when it comes to hockey. Since the New York Rangers joined the NHL in 1926, MSG has been the team’s home arena. Over the years, the Garden has hosted countless memorable games, including Stanley Cup Finals and All-Star Games.
The current iteration of MSG, which opened in 1968, has seen its fair share of legendary moments. From Wayne Gretzky’s historic goal-scoring streak to the Rangers’ Stanley Cup victory in 1994, the arena has been a witness to hockey greatness.
